SQLStatics 函数
功能
检索表的索引相关信息。
函数原型
c
SQLRETURN SQLStatistics(
SQLHSTMT StatementHandle,
SQLCHAR * CatalogName,
SQLSMALLINT NameLength1,
SQLCHAR * SchemaName,
SQLSMALLINT NameLength2,
SQLCHAR * TableName,
SQLSMALLINT NameLength3,
SQLUSMALLINT Unique,
SQLUSMALLINT Reserved);
参数解释
- StatementHandle:语句句柄。
- CatalogName:数据库名,char类型的字符串。
- NameLength1:以字节为单位描述参数CatalogName字符串的长度。
- SchemaName:模式名,char类型的字符串。
- NameLength2:以字节为单位描述参数SchemaName字符串的长度。
- TableName:表名,char类型的字符串。
- NameLength3:以字节为单位描述参数TableName字符串的长度。
- Unique:是否指定唯一值索引。可填值为:SQL_INDEX_UNIQUE、SQL_INDEX_AL。
- Reserved:标识索引信息是即时更新还是延迟更新,当为延迟更新时,驱动不保证某些信息是当前即时的。
返回值
成功时返回SQL_SUCCESS。